1990 Mercedes Benz 420SE - Immaculate condition
We are amazed on very many occasions with some of the fabulous cars arriving in the Mews here
This 420SE is just one of those - 2 owners since new and with a full service book to validate the mileage, of course
However to look at the car and to drive it too, you would happily suggest about 16.000 miles have been travelled
Amazingly she has 76.000 miles under her belt - never restored, just carefully looked after
The paintwork, wheel discs and bright work is immaculate and moreover the interior looks as though it's still brand new
Seat upholstery is quite phenomenal - we haven't seen any quite like this before
Engine bay again, which we haven't even dusted off, is like it would have been on the showroom floor in 1990
Fitted with heated seats, electric sunroof and air conditioning she is all set up for some lovely days out, or even being used for Ascot, Henley, Wimbledon or Goodwood too
The 420SE with the standard wheelbase is a little rocket ship and can dance up to 100 mph in mere seconds - with a nice V8 burble as you waft along
A nicer example would be difficult to find - anywhere!
